The SMAJ15A-13 from Diodes Incorporated is a robust transient voltage suppressor (TVS) diode designed to protect s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events. This TVS diode is a popular choice for safeguarding voltage sensitive components which can be affected by sudden voltage spikes.
Key Features
- Stand-Off Voltage: The device features a stand-off voltage of 15V, which is the maximum voltage that can be applied while the device remains in a non-conductive state.
- Peak Pulse Power: It can handle a peak pulse power of 400W for 10/1000μs waveform, ensuring effective protection against high energy transients.
- Clamping Voltage: In the event of a voltage spike, the SMAJ15A-13 clamps to a maximum voltage of 24.4V, preventing damage to the protected component.
- Fast Response Time: The device reacts in less than 1 picosecond from 0V to BV min, offering immediate protection against transient voltages.
- Low Incremental Surge Resistance: With its low incremental surge resistance, the diode provides high performance and reliability.
- Operating Temperature Range: It operates effectively within a temperature range of -55°C to +150°C, suitable for various environments.

Quality and Standards
Constructed with high-quality materials, the SMAJ15A-13 meets or exceeds industry standards for performance and reliability. It is compliant with the RoHS directive, ensuring that it is free from hazardous substances. The device is also provided in an SMA package, known for its compact footprint and low profile, making it suitable for high-density circuit board designs.
